Why did hammarabi have his laws engraved in stone and placed in a public place

This was a very tactical move.

1) this meant that his laws were known to everyone: this reminded the people that they had to obey the law and took away the excuse of "I didn't know".

2) in a case of dispute, people could go to the stone and access the law: this made the legal disputes easier to settle.
